Product Review-Rimmel Apocalips

 

I know that these have been around for a little while, but since their release in January I've built up a mini collection of them that can suit all different occasions. Apocalips are a Lip Lacquer which basically translates to a liquid lipstick in the form of a lip-gloss. They come with a doe foot applicator and glide onto the lips beautifully. These are extremely well pigmented and are pretty long lasting which is perfect as it means you're more likely to use less of the product.
I now have 4 different shades of Apocalips; Apocaliptic, Galaxy, Nude Eclipse and Out Of This World. Apocaliptic is the brightest of the shade. It is a gorgeous fuchsia pink, a very bold and bright shade that would be perfect on a night out teamed with minimalistic eyes. Galaxy is the deepest shade I own. It is a deep plum colour and looks lovely with a smoky eye to create a more vamp look. Nude Eclipse is probably my least favourite shade as you can't really tell you're wearing it. It is as the name suggests, a nude colour but it can almost look like you've smothered you're lips in foundation. I use this one the least, it can look quite nice with very dramatic eyes or a lot of contouring though. My newest shade to the collection is Out Of This World and I think it will soon become a favourite. Its a very wearable pink glossy colour. This shade could easily be worn during the day or on an evening, its very universal and would suit most skin tones.
This product is a lovely idea and does work really well with the right shade. My favourite thing about the product is the pigmentation because sometimes I struggle to get bold lips as I don't always build up the colour, so these are perfect for me.
